RESOLUTION
Expressing support for the designation of March 21, 2023, as ``National
Agriculture Day'' and celebrating the importance of agriculture as one
of the most impactful industries in the United States.
Resolved, That the House of Representatives--
(1) expresses support for the designation of ``National
Agriculture Day''; and
(2) celebrates the importance of agriculture as one of the
most impactful industries in the United States.
